Tang 2017
| Study characteristics | |||
| Patient sampling | Cross‐sectional design, consecutive enrolment, prospective data collection | ||
| Patient characteristics and setting | Presenting signs and symptoms: clinical suspicion of TB Age: median 36 years, range 16 to 78 years Sex, female: 47% HIV infection: not reported History of TB: not reported Sample size: 240 Clinical setting: not reported Laboratory level: central Country: China World Bank Income Classification: middle income High TB burden country: yes High MDR‐TB burden country: yes High TB/HIV burden country: yes Prevalence of TB cases in the study: 36.0% |
||
| Index tests | Index: Xpert MTB/RIF | ||
| Target condition and reference standard(s) | Target condition: pulmonary TB Reference standard for pulmonary TB: MGIT 960 Target condition: rifampicin resistance Reference standard for rifampicin resistance: MGIT 960 |
||
| Flow and timing | |||
| Comparative | |||
| Notes | Study authors considered the quality of specimens, collection, transport, and testing times as possible explanations for low Xpert specificity in this study | ||
